linux-kernel.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
* [PATCH v1 0/8] Support for secondary cores on Tegra30
@ 2012-01-26 17:07 Peter De Schrijver
  2012-01-26 17:07 ` [PATCH v1 1/8] ARM: tegra: introduce support for reading chipid Peter De Schrijver
                   ` (7 more replies)
  0 siblings, 8 replies; 16+ messages in thread
From: Peter De Schrijver @ 2012-01-26 17:07 UTC (permalink / raw)
  To: Peter De Schrijver
  Cc: Colin Cross, Olof Johansson, Stephen Warren, Russell King,
	Gary King, Arnd Bergmann, linux-tegra, linux-arm-kernel,
	linux-kernel

Implement bringing up secondary cores on Tegra30. This involves unpowergating
the appropriate domains enabling the CPU clocks and releasing the reset lines.

Peter De Schrijver (8):
  ARM: tegra: introduce support for reading chipid
  ARM: tegra: functions to access the flowcontroller
  ARM: tegra: rework Tegra secondary CPU core bringup
  ARM: tegra: prepare powergate.c for multiple variants
  ARM: tegra: export tegra_powergate_is_powered()
  ARM: tegra: add support for Tegra30 powerdomains
  ARM: tegra: support for Tegra30 CPU powerdomains
  ARM: tegra: support for secondary cores on Tegra30

 arch/arm/mach-tegra/Makefile                 |    2 +
 arch/arm/mach-tegra/chipid.h                 |   38 +++++
 arch/arm/mach-tegra/common.c                 |    3 +
 arch/arm/mach-tegra/flowctrl.c               |   62 ++++++++
 arch/arm/mach-tegra/flowctrl.h               |    5 +
 arch/arm/mach-tegra/headsmp.S                |  192 ++++++++++++++++++++++++-
 arch/arm/mach-tegra/include/mach/iomap.h     |    3 +
 arch/arm/mach-tegra/include/mach/powergate.h |   15 ++-
 arch/arm/mach-tegra/platsmp.c                |  139 +++++++++++++------
 arch/arm/mach-tegra/powergate.c              |   53 +++++++-
 arch/arm/mach-tegra/reset.c                  |   82 +++++++++++
 arch/arm/mach-tegra/reset.h                  |   50 +++++++
 12 files changed, 588 insertions(+), 56 deletions(-)
 create mode 100644 arch/arm/mach-tegra/chipid.h
 create mode 100644 arch/arm/mach-tegra/flowctrl.c
 create mode 100644 arch/arm/mach-tegra/reset.c
 create mode 100644 arch/arm/mach-tegra/reset.h

-- 
1.7.7.rc0.72.g4b5ea.dirty


^ permalink raw reply	[flat|nested] 16+ messages in thread

end of thread, other threads:[~2012-02-02 17:32 UTC | newest]

Thread overview: 16+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2012-01-26 17:07 [PATCH v1 0/8] Support for secondary cores on Tegra30 Peter De Schrijver
2012-01-26 17:07 ` [PATCH v1 1/8] ARM: tegra: introduce support for reading chipid Peter De Schrijver
2012-01-27  8:19   ` Olof Johansson
2012-01-26 17:07 ` [PATCH v1 2/8] ARM: tegra: functions to access the flowcontroller Peter De Schrijver
2012-01-26 17:07 ` [PATCH v1 3/8] ARM: tegra: rework Tegra secondary CPU core bringup Peter De Schrijver
2012-01-26 20:25   ` Stephen Warren
2012-01-27  8:18     ` Peter De Schrijver
2012-02-02 17:32       ` Stephen Warren
2012-01-26 17:07 ` [PATCH v1 4/8] ARM: tegra: prepare powergate.c for multiple variants Peter De Schrijver
2012-01-26 17:07 ` [PATCH v1 5/8] ARM: tegra: export tegra_powergate_is_powered() Peter De Schrijver
2012-01-26 17:07 ` [PATCH v1 6/8] ARM: tegra: add support for Tegra30 powerdomains Peter De Schrijver
2012-01-26 17:07 ` [PATCH v1 7/8] ARM: tegra: support for Tegra30 CPU powerdomains Peter De Schrijver
2012-01-26 20:40   ` Stephen Warren
2012-01-26 17:07 ` [PATCH v1 8/8] ARM: tegra: support for secondary cores on Tegra30 Peter De Schrijver
2012-01-26 20:44   ` Stephen Warren
2012-01-27  5:58   ` Murali N

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).